Ticket #2093 — Health check hardening behind the Quillmere LB

We are changing the health endpoint on the Quillmere application tier to require a signed header from the load balancer, preventing unauthenticated probes from revealing dependency status. The change includes a fallback window of 48 hours during which unsigned probes log warnings but still pass. Please review the header validation logic and the fallback expiry handling. Security sign-off is required from the reviewer named below.

named custodian: Brivan Eliath Quenox Frador

## Rotation Cadence — Vaultspin Utility

Vaultspin rotates service credentials for all Merridew-platform workloads on a staggered schedule to avoid thundering-herd renewals against the broker. Each rotation window is jittered, and failed rotations fall back to the previous credential for a bounded grace period before alerting. Before signing off the release, please verify the staging overrides were reverted to production defaults. The constants below govern cadence, jitter, and grace behavior; confirm each against the runbook.

tuning constants:
QUOTAS = {
    "druwyn": 5,
    "holix": 5,
    "zorath": 5,
    "holwyn": 10,
}

Meeting notes — Q3 stock-count review, Harrowgate Depot. Attendees: shift leads and inventory clerk. The quarterly ledger for aisles 4–9 reconciled cleanly except for two pallets of Vexley fittings, now flagged for recount Thursday. Marta will lock the counting sheets in the cage until sign-off. The bound ledger itself must travel to the Fenbrook office for audit stamping before Friday noon. A courier from Quillhart Transit will collect it; the confidential hand-over instruction follows below.

handover note for yagef-bagep: the drudor pelius courier leaves the kasdor zorvan norir ledger at gate 8016 under passcode 755406

## Who to ping about GiftNote

Welcome aboard! GiftNote is our donation-receipt mailer for the Larchfield Fund. Template tweaks go to the comms folks; delivery failures and bounce weirdness go to the platform crew. Don't push template changes on Fridays — receipts batch over the weekend. For anything GiftNote-related, start with the address below.

billing contact of kaweg-tajeg = drudor.lamion.oliath@torvalabs.test